This invention relates to roller painters, and more particularly to a device intended for use in marking trame lines on highways.
An important object of the invention is to provide a simple and relatively inexpensive device means of which lines may be quickly andv easily applied to highways or any other desired surfaces.
A further object is to provide a device of the character referred to wherein a roller is employed fo-r applying paint to the desired surface and wherein novel means is employed for supporting the roller and for supplying paint thereto.
A further object is to provide novel means for controlling the flow of paint from the roller.
A further object is to provide a novel form of fabric applicator covering the roller to insure a uniform distribution of paint.
A further object is to provide a roller having spaced openings for the flow of paint therethrough and provided with an absorbent fabric covering to insure the distribution of paint throughout the periphery of the roller and thus insure the uniform desired surface.
A further object is to provide a roller painter of the character referred to wherein the roller is readily demountable to permit the use of different rollers for any purpose, as where painted lines of different widths are desired.
A further object is to provide a painting device of the character referred to having means for supporting the roller with respect to the supply tank, and to provide means for supplying paint to the interior of the roller axially thereof.
A further object is to provide common means for supporting the roller for rotation about its axis and for supplying paint or other surface coating composition to the interior of the roller.
Other objects and advantages of the invention will become apparent during the course of the following description.

The operation of the form of the invention shown in Figures 1, 2 and 3 is as follows:
The roller is effectively supported for rotation by the single arm i3, thus leaving the opposite side of the roller free to permit the supplying of surface coating composition to the interior of the roller. The sleeve i8 rigidly connects the arm lil to the tank independently of the hose and pipe connections at the opposite side of the'roller, and
the latter connections supply paintaxially to the roller. The paint is supplied to the absorbent covering 4S which peripherally distributes the paint, and in operation, it merely is necessary for the operator to grasp the handles I 3 and push the device to roll the roller over the line which' it is desired to paint. When the painting operation is completed, the valvev device is closed by operating the handle-38; Under such condtions each valve 3l closes its associated opening 34. It will be noted that theclamping bolts 23 normally lie in the relative positions shown in Figure 3, and accordingly they do not interfere with the rotary movement of the valve device to closed position.
The cover 45, with its elastic bands I6 servesnot only to yuniformly distribute the paint peripherally with respect to the roller butV also excludes air from the interior thereof. The device is particularly adapted for marking traffic lines on'highways, as will be apparent.
The operation of the form of the device shown in Figure 4 is identical with that previously described, the only difference lying in the provision of means for positively supplying paint to the roller, thus permitting the device to be used in any position. The pressure supply means shown inl Figure 4, of course, is unnecessary in paintingv traffic lines on highways since the device is used in such a position that' there is a free gravity flow of paint to the roller at all times.
As soon as the use of the device has been completed, the rubber hose connections may be readily removed, whereupon the screws 28 may be removed to permit the roller to be detached from the arm I9. The cover is then readily removable by stretching one of the bands 45 over the roller, whereupon all of the parts of the device may be cleaned by using a suitable solvent according to the surface composition being employed.
The purpose of the plurality of studs I 4 and nipples I5 is to permit rollers of different sizes to be employed. Where wider rollers are employed, such rollers may be supported from the F outer stud Il! by a suitable arm I9, and hose and piping connections similar to those illustrated may be connected to the outer nipple I5, as will be apparent. The plug I'I will be removed, of course, when the hose connection 32 is to be connected to the outer nipple I5, the plug I'I, under such conditions, being secured into the inner nipple I5.
The operation of the form of the invention shown in Figures 5, 6 and '7 will be apparent from the foregoing description. The device is rolled over the surface to be treated in the same manner as the forms of the device previously described, and when the parts are connected in the manner shown in Figure 6, the surface coating composition will flow from the tube 53 to the pipe 65 and thence through the axial extension 6l into the interior of theroller. The paint is discharged from the roller through the openings 60 and is absorbed by the covering 'I5 to be uniformly spread peripherally with respect to the roller to insure a unform application of the paint. The openings 6i! may be closed by operating the handleV 63 to rotate the valve disk 6I, each valve 62 closing one set of openings 60.
Instead of connecting the pipes as shown in Figure 6, the pipe E5 may be threaded on either Aof the tubes 54, thus adapting the device for applying paint on inclined surfaces. If the pipe 65 is connected to one of the tubes 54, the cap 55 from the latter tube isv threaded on the tube 53 tovforml a closure therefor.
VFrom the foregoing it will be apparent that either form of the device forms simple and effective means for applying paint and other surface coating compositions wherever desired, and the device islparticularly adapted for use in painting trafc lines on highways. The fabric covering in each case takes the place of a brush and remains saturated with paint as long as the device is in operation, thus insuring the uniform application of paint where desired.
